What type of oil does a 2016 Hyundai Genesis take?

  • The 2016 Hyundai Genesis 5.0 performs best with full synthetic oil that meets Hyundai OEM specifications; synthetic oil helps protect the V8 at higher temperatures and RPMs.
  • Using OEM-recommended oil preserves performance, supports emissions systems, and helps maintain factory warranty coverage; remember warranty repairs require certified dealership service.

How much oil does a 2016 Hyundai Genesis need?

  • The 5.0 V8 in the 2016 Hyundai Genesis typically requires approximately 6–8 quarts of full synthetic oil depending on filter and drain practices; your service invoice will show the exact quantity used.
  • Correct fill levels are critical for protecting bearings and maintaining consistent horsepower and torque across RPM ranges.
